Marge is a narrative researcher.  Which of the following is most likely the goal for her study of young boys' sports injuries?
◦ To explore the experiences of injured youth athletes and their families
◦ To increase awareness of sports injuries in youth sport
◦ To help to develop awareness of the long term consequences of youth sport injuries
◦ To catalog the number and type of injuries in a single calendar year
Title: Marge is a narrative researcher. Which of the following is most likely the goal for her study of ...
Post by: komodo7 on Mar 8, 2019
To explore the experiences of injured youth athletes and their families
